Bottom vent open 1/8 inch and top adjusted 1/4 open, 1/2 open, fully open, depending on weather conditions and what temp you want. I take a full chimney of charcoal and dump 1/3 on one side 1/3 on the other ( two piles of charcoal on one side of the grill ) leaving a gap in the middle then light the remaining 1/3 and dump it in the gap. This should give 3 to 4 hrs of consistent heat. That's how l do it.

No, I think those are called back ribs. They usually don't have much meat on them because the ribeye meat is more expensive so they trim them as close to the bone as possible. These are near the chuck roast or chuck roll. Just ask for sort rib whole rack, or plate ribs if you can find them. The plate ribs are the first 3 bones of the short ribs and have more meat than the short ribs. Back ribs are very tasty too, just a lot less meat.

This is husband, salt and pepper rub, 250 for 6hrs, wrapped in butcher paper after 4 hrs. Let it cook till probe tender, about 203-205°. Rested wrapped up for 1hr. Used pecan wood.
